Testimony of Adin Talber, born in Berlin, Germany, 1921, regarding his experiences just before the outbreak of the war and his aliya to Eretz Israel, late 1935
Childhood and family background in Berlin; service of his father as a physician during World War I; attendance at the Theodor Herzl school; Kadima and Maccabi Hatzair youth movements; expulsion of students without German citizenship from the Goethe School; arrest of his father by the German police and prohibition on his continued service as a physician; sport activities; expulsion of Jews from German sports clubs; joining Bar Kochva sport movement; changes in life in Germany.
Aliya to Eretz Israel, late 1935; drafted into the Jewish Brigade; Bergen-Belsen; photographing life in the Bergen-Belsen DP camp and detention by the British Army on account of the filming; life in Israel.
